InMoment vs SurveyJS: the quick answer
InMoment wins this comparison with a 4.4/5 rating versus SurveyJS’s 4.3/5. InMoment is the stronger choice for most teams, especially enterprise brands that need customer experience, employee feedback, and market research data in one place. SurveyJS gives developers complete control over survey UI through its JavaScript library, but InMoment has the comprehensive analytics and business intelligence tools that most organizations actually need to turn feedback into action.
Where InMoment wins
InMoment crushes it when you need to connect survey data to business outcomes. The platform puts customer experience (CX) and employee experience (EX) data in a single dashboard. You can correlate customer satisfaction scores with employee engagement metrics. This matters for enterprise brands trying to understand how internal culture affects customer perception.
The AI-powered text analytics give InMoment a huge edge over SurveyJS’s bare-bones approach. InMoment automatically processes open-ended responses for sentiment analysis and theme identification. Hours of manual review become minutes of automated insights. SurveyJS collects the responses and dumps everything on you.
Enterprise compliance and security heavily favor InMoment. The platform includes HIPAA compliance for healthcare organizations and handles data governance requirements that large companies face. SurveyJS puts all security responsibilities on your development team. Good luck with that audit.
InMoment’s team collaboration features support complex organizational workflows that SurveyJS simply doesn’t address. Multiple stakeholders can access dashboards, share insights, and coordinate follow-up actions without technical knowledge. With SurveyJS, every user needs developer involvement to access or interpret data.
Where SurveyJS wins
SurveyJS is unbeatable when you need surveys embedded directly in your application with complete UI control. The JavaScript library renders surveys that match your exact design system and user experience. InMoment forces you to work within their interface constraints.
Cost efficiency strongly favors SurveyJS for development teams. The core library uses an MIT license and costs nothing forever. Even the commercial version at $999 per year costs a fraction of InMoment’s enterprise pricing. Perfect for startups or internal applications with budget constraints.
Technical flexibility gives SurveyJS a major advantage for custom implementations. You control hosting, data storage, and integration with your existing systems. The JSON-based survey definition makes it easy to programmatically generate surveys or integrate with your development workflow. InMoment locks you into their hosted environment.
SurveyJS handles offline data collection better than InMoment’s cloud-dependent platform. Field researchers or mobile applications can collect responses without internet connectivity, then sync later. This is essential for certain research scenarios that InMoment simply can’t support.
Pricing compared
The pricing models reflect completely different target markets. SurveyJS starts free with its MIT-licensed core library. Any developer willing to handle their own hosting and data management can use it. The commercial version adds PDF exports and dashboard features for $999 annually.
InMoment uses enterprise-only custom pricing that typically starts in the tens of thousands annually. You’re paying for dedicated customer success support, advanced analytics infrastructure, and compliance certifications. The value proposition works when you need sophisticated text analytics and business intelligence, but smaller organizations are priced out entirely.
The hidden costs favor different directions. SurveyJS appears cheaper upfront but requires developer time for implementation, hosting costs, and ongoing maintenance. InMoment’s higher price includes infrastructure, support, and feature development that would cost significantly more to build internally.
Features that matter for this decision
Advanced analytics create the biggest feature gap between these tools. InMoment processes responses automatically with AI-powered sentiment analysis and trend identification. You get executive dashboards and statistical analysis without additional work. SurveyJS collects raw data but has no analysis tools. You build or buy those separately.
API access works differently for each platform. InMoment has APIs for integrating with existing business systems like CRM or customer support platforms. SurveyJS is fundamentally an API. The entire survey experience runs through programmatic control. Choose based on whether you want to connect to a survey platform or embed survey capability.
Custom branding reaches different depths. Both tools support branded surveys, but SurveyJS gives complete control over every visual element since it renders in your application. InMoment has branding options within their interface framework. The difference matters if survey appearance must match your exact design specifications.
Team collaboration separates business users from technical users. InMoment includes built-in sharing, commenting, and workflow features for non-technical stakeholders. SurveyJS requires custom development for any collaboration beyond basic data access. This gap widens significantly in larger organizations with diverse user needs.
Who should choose InMoment
Choose InMoment if you’re an enterprise brand that needs to combine customer feedback, employee surveys, and market research in sophisticated analytics dashboards. InMoment works best when you have budget for enterprise software, need HIPAA compliance, or want AI-powered text analytics without building your own infrastructure. The platform suits organizations where business users need direct access to insights and technical complexity should stay hidden.
Who should choose SurveyJS
Choose SurveyJS if you’re a developer building custom applications that need embedded survey functionality with complete UI control. SurveyJS is ideal when you need surveys that look and behave exactly like the rest of your application, have technical skills to handle hosting and analytics, or require offline data collection. The library works best for software companies, research applications, or internal tools where survey capability supports a larger product experience.



